March 2020 marked the launch of LIVDEN, a curated line of innovative decorative tiles made from 60-100% recycled materials. In the months leading up to our launch, we were approached by Palm Springs design firm, Juniper House, for a collaboration on one of the featured homes of 2020 Modernism Week, the Mesa Modern.
The LUNA series in the Medallion color on 12x12 Crystallized Terrazzo tile was featured as the main kitchen's backsplash. The LUNA was paired with matte black cabinetry, brass hardware, and custom mid-century lighting installations. The main kitchen was packed with color, texture and modern design elements.

Our clients returned to their home in Burke, Virginia, after renting it during military assignments. Their outdated and cramped kitchen did not work for their busy family. They turned to FA Design Build to redesign the look and layout of the space. Originally, the space was a breakfast nook, a small U-shaped kitchen, and a garage entryway. By removing a framed pantry, bulkheads, and walls, we opened the space the length of the house. The result is an open concept room that serves as the hub of the home. The design incorporates stained cherry cabinetry, Armstrong Vivero luxury vinyl floor, and quartz countertops -- all ideals choices for beauty and low maintenance living.
